Description | Scutebarbatine B shows weak cytotoxicity with IC50 values ranging from 35.11 to 42.73 μM against K562 cell lines and HL60 cell lines. |
In vitro | Bioassay-guided isolation of the aerial part of Scutellaria barbata yielded three new neo-clerodane diterpenoids scutebatas P-R (1-3), together with two known ones: scutebata E (4) and Scutebarbatine B (5). The chemical structures of the isolated compounds were elucidated by spectroscopic methods (NMR and MS) and by comparison with the spectroscopic data reported in the literature. |
